What Happens From Dispatch Through Drop-Off

After you call, we confirm your location, vehicle type, and whether the breakdown involves traffic lanes or shoulder parking, then send the nearest available truck to your spot in Grand Junction. Our drivers arrive with wheel lifts, flatbeds, and dollies that match your car's weight and drivetrain configuration, and they load your vehicle without scraping paint or bending suspension parts.

Once your car is secured and strapped down, you ride along to your destination or arrange separate transport while we deliver the vehicle. You receive a receipt showing pickup time, drop-off location, and mileage, and your car sits exactly where you requested it, ready for a mechanic or storage lockup.

We tow from accident scenes managed by law enforcement, private lots where parking rules apply, and open highway shoulders during snowstorms and summer monsoons. If your vehicle leaks fluids or sustained frame damage, we notify you before loading and adjust our equipment to prevent further harm during the haul.

How quickly can D&J Towing reach my vehicle in Grand Junction?
Response times depend on your exact location and current call volume, but we dispatch the closest available truck immediately and most drivers arrive within 20 to 40 minutes. Highway breakdowns along I-70 and Highway 50 often receive faster service due to direct access routes.

What types of vehicles can your emergency towing service handle?
We tow sedans, SUVs, pickup trucks, and specialty vehicles using flatbeds, wheel lifts, and integrated tow equipment designed for front-wheel, rear-wheel, and all-wheel-drive configurations. If your vehicle has custom suspension or low ground clearance, let us know during the call so we bring the right setup.

What happens if my car breaks down during a snowstorm or extreme heat?
We operate in all weather conditions and our trucks carry chains, recovery straps, and safety lighting for winter storms and low-visibility situations. Summer heat does not stop service, though we may adjust loading procedures if asphalt softens or engine components remain hot enough to cause burns.

How do I know my vehicle will not get damaged during the tow?
Our drivers inspect your car before loading, photograph existing damage, and use padded straps and adjustable cradles that distribute weight without crushing body panels or suspension parts. You receive the same vehicle condition at drop-off that we documented at pickup.
